- Start off with a hearty breakfast at Kokako Cafe before heading off to explore Auckland's city centre.
- Take in the stunning panoramic views of the city from the top of the Sky Tower.
- Visit the vibrant and bustling Auckland Fish Market, where you can sample a variety of fresh seafood.
- Wander through the beautiful Auckland Domain park and check out the impressive Auckland War Memorial Museum.
- Enjoy a romantic dinner at harbor-side restaurant, Saint Alice, where you can indulge in delicious seafood dishes while gazing out at the sea.
- Hotel recommendation: Sofitel Auckland Viaduct Harbour luxurious 5-star hotel located right on Auckland's picturesque waterfront.
- Take an early morning drive to Waiheke Island, a wine-making hub just a short ferry ride from Auckland.
- Explore the island's vineyards and cellar doors, stopping in at Mudbrick and Cable Bay Vineyards for some delicious wine tastings and stunning views.
- Enjoy a leisurely lunch at The Oyster Inn, where you can indulge in fresh seafood and some of Waiheke's finest wines.
- Take a scenic drive back to Auckland and enjoy a romantic dinner at Gusto at the Grand, where you can indulge in some of the city's best Italian cuisine.
- Head out of the city to the beautiful Waitakere Ranges Regional Park, where you can go for a hike through the lush rainforest and take in some stunning waterfalls and scenic views.
- Stop in at Arataki Visitor Centre to learn more about the park and its natural wonders.
- Return to Auckland and grab a quick bite to eat at the famous Giapo Gelato.
- Take a thrilling ride up the Sky Tower and enjoy panoramic views of the city.
- Finish your trip with a romantic dinner at The Sugar Club, where you can indulge in some innovative and delicious cuisine while taking in stunning views of Auckland's skyline.
- Hotel recommendation: Hotel DeBrett quirky and stylish boutique hotel located in the heart of Auckland's bustling city centre.

How to get there
Plane
The best way to get to Auckland, New Zealand by plane is to fly into Auckland Airport, which is the largest airport in the country with direct flights from cities all over the world.
Car
If driving, the best way to get to Auckland, New Zealand is by taking State Highway 1, which runs from both the north and south of the country and passes through Auckland.
Train

Boat
While Auckland is a coastal city with a busy port, the best way to arrive by boat would be to take a cruise to New Zealand and dock at the Port of Auckland.
Bus
The best way to get to Auckland, New Zealand by bus is to take a long haul bus such as the InterCity from major cities such as Wellington or Christchurch.
